Wolf Gold is a medium-volatility Pragmatic Play video slot with 25 fixed paylines, giant-symbol Free Spins and a Money Respin grid where locked moon values can award jackpots.
Linked middle reels reshape Free Spins, while six moon values open a separate respin grid that resets after every new lock.

How giant reels connect
Line wins are checked from the left across twenty-five fixed routes on a 5 x 3 grid. Wild symbols substitute for regular pay symbols, while Scatters and money moons open separate bonus paths after the base result settles.
Three Scatters award five Free Spins and merge reels two through four into one linked giant-symbol area. Additional Scatter sets add three spins, so the combined middle section can remain active through successive retriggers.
Six or more money moons start three respins on a fifteen-position grid. New moons lock and restore the counter to three; when no respins remain, every displayed value is added and paid together.
The Money Respin can trigger during Free Spins.
The linked middle reels pause while the cash grid resolves.

Where moon values concentrate
Base-game value is distributed across fixed paylines, but the larger structural change occurs in Free Spins when three middle reels become one symbol. That link can cover several line positions, yet it must still connect with eligible symbols on the outer reels.
The Money Respin isolates payout value inside locked moon amounts and fixed jackpots. A displayed moon is not paid immediately; it becomes actual value only after the respin sequence ends and the visible amounts are totalled.
The x2,500 listed maximum accompanies medium volatility and 96.01% RTP. Giant-symbol coverage, repeated retriggers and a crowded money grid create different routes to value, but none guarantees a qualifying payline or completed bonus grid.
